ℹ️General Overview

For babies 6–12 months (older infants), this ingredient is likely low risk when used on the skin in normal baby products. It’s a skin-conditioning silicone that doesn’t absorb much into the body. But there is limited baby-specific data and a small chance of irritation, so use a little caution.

What to Do

Use products made for babies and avoid spray or mist forms that could be breathed in. Do a small patch test on a baby’s inner forearm and wait 24 hours before wider use. Don’t put it on broken or red skin and keep it away from the baby’s eyes and mouth. Use only as directed on the product label and follow any concentration guidance from the manufacturer.

⚠️Warnings

Watch for skin redness, itching, eye watering, coughing, or breathing changes — these signs of irritation are reported by the European Chemicals Agency. Industry safety reviews note gaps in concentration and impurity data (Cosmetic Ingredient Review), so avoid products that list very high concentrations or are not intended for baby use. Environment Canada has raised concerns about possible environmental toxicity; this affects disposal and environmental impact, not direct baby skin safety.

Safety Risk Labels

This ingredient has the following documented risks:

Organ Risk: The European Chemicals Agency (ECHA) has classified phenyl trimethicone as very toxic or harmful to non-reproductive organs, and other reviews list a low-to-moderate concern for organ system effects. Industry safety reviews also note data gaps and that safety depends on how the ingredient is used and at what concentration. Because of the ECHA finding and the noted uncertainty, there is a real risk to organs with repeated or high exposures.
Environmental: Environment Canada flagged phenyl trimethicone as a suspected environmental toxin and noted uncertainty about its effects. This means the chemical may harm wildlife or ecosystems if released, so there is a possible environmental risk.
